Flagwright rollout: bump stage percentages only via the `stagectl` script, never by editing the manifest directly. The manifest is regenerated nightly and manual edits get clobbered. If a flag sticks at 0% after promotion, restart the evaluator pods in the Kestrel cluster and re-run the sync job. Verify with `flagwright verify --env prod` before closing the change. Record the trace token from the verify output below.

pipeline stamp: htk9_ce63042d9

## Releases

Orbelisk evaluates user-supplied formulas inside the Quarrow sandbox, so every release must rebuild the sandbox image and run the full escape-test suite before tagging. Never ship if any isolation test is skipped. Once the suite passes, sign the release artifact with the key provided below.

rollout seal: bky3_Zik

MEMO — Dispatch desk. Twelve returned demo units from the Ostervik trade show are boxed and tagged in Bay 3. All units must go back to Fenwright Systems on tomorrow's first run. Verify tag count against the return sheet before loading. No substitutions, no partial loads. The courier hand-over instruction is appended below.

handover note for yagef-bagep: the drudor pelius courier leaves the kasdor zorvan norir ledger at gate 8016 under passcode 755406